loud-ninja
Here to point out the illogical
Just go on youtube. Plenty of people streaming itTook me an whole hour to figure it out
Did my googles and there was no clear answer.
Created apple tv and ITunes accounts, downloaded both and they want you to verify a bunch of shit for no reason